Where is the bus station in Chiang Rai and how to get there?

In Chiang Rai, there are two main bus stations: Old (for local and regional routes) and New (for intercity and international). Their location is very important to avoid going in the wrong direction.
1. Old Bus Station (Old Bus Station / Terminal 1) is located right in the city center, near the night market and main hotels (view on map). Buses from Chiang Mai arrive here, and minibuses depart to Chiang Rai province (e.g., to the Golden Triangle, Mae Sai). You can get here from any point in the center on foot or by tuk-tuk for 50-60 baht.
2. New Bus Station (New Bus Station / Terminal 2) is located 7 km south of the center (view on map). All buses from Bangkok, Pattaya and other distant cities arrive here. To get from here to the city, you need to take a songthaew minibus (orange or white). The fare is 25 baht per person, but the driver may wait until enough passengers are gathered. An alternative is a taxi for 200-300 baht.
Don't mix them up! Be sure to check which station your bus arrives at. If you are coming from Chiang Mai, you go to the Old station. If from Bangkok or the south of the country, to the New one.
